A reredos in three panels in the apse of the ruined chapel, with the central panel inlaid in coloured marbles and a mosaic picture of Saint George slaying the dragon. There are names in black in the two side panels of white stone, borders, and frieze of coloured mosaic. After destruction by a flying bomb in 1944 the chapel remains a roofless shell with just the lower parts of the walling remaining, except at the west end where the entrance porch is largely intact.

Inscription description

central frieze: TO THE GLORY OF GOD / AND IN MEMORY OF THOSE OF ALL RANKS OF THE ROYAL AND LATE INDIAN ARTILLERY WHO WON THE VICTORIA CROSS / DEDICATED BY THE REGIMENT A.D. 1920; left panel: RANK WHEN V.C. / WAS WON / DATE OF DEATH / CRIMEA 1854-5 / (Names) / KARS 1855 / (Name) / INDIAN MUTINY 1857-8 / (Names) / NEW ZEALAND 1863-4 / (Names); right panel: RANK WHEN V.C. / WAS WON / DATE OF DEATH / AFGHANISTAN 1880 / (Names) / SOUDAN 1885 / (Name) / SOUTH AFRICA 1899-1901 / (Names) / THE GREAT WAR 1914-18 / (Names) / 1939-45 WAR / (Names)
